==Input data== | ==Input data== | ||
+ | With the installation of Heureka, there are three climate model scenarios available: | ||
+ | |||
+ | :'''MPI 4.5''': Based on Max Planck Institute [http://www.mpimet.mpg.de/en/science/models/mpi-esm/ MPI-ESM model] using radiation scenario RCP 4.5, which assumes that radiative forcing stabilises at 4.5 W/m² before the year 2100. See also [http://www.smhi.se/en/climate/climate-scenarios#area=eur&dnr=0&sc=rcp45&seas=ar&var=t RCP4.5 at SMHI's homepage]. | ||
+ | :'''MPI 8.5''': Based on Max Planck Institute [http://www.mpimet.mpg.de/en/science/models/mpi-esm/ MPI-ESM model] using radiation scenario RCP 4.5, which assumes that radiative forcing stabilises at 8.5 W/m² before the year 2100.. See also [http://www.smhi.se/en/climate/climate-scenarios#area=eur&dnr=0&sc=rcp85&seas=ar&var=t RCP8.5 at SMHI's homepage] | ||
+ | :'''ECHAMS_A1B''': Based on Max Planck Institute climate model [http://www.mpimet.mpg.de/en/science/models/echam.html ECHAM] using emission scenario SRES A1B. | ||
